# Formaggi

**Formaggi** is a traditional Italian cheese-based dish that exemplifies the country's rich dairy heritage and regional culinary traditions. The name, derived from the Italian word for "cheeses," reflects the dish's fundamental character as a celebration of multiple cheese varieties.

## Origin and Tradition

Formaggi emerged from the Alpine and northern Italian regions, where dairy farming has been central to the economy and cuisine for centuries. The dish represents a practical solution to cheese preservation and consumption, transforming various local cheeses into a cohesive, flavorful preparation. Its roots trace to medieval Italian cooking, where combining aged and fresh cheeses was both economical and gastronomically sophisticated.

## Key Characteristics

A distinguished formaggi relies on the careful selection and balance of complementary cheeses, typically combining hard aged varieties with softer, creamier options. The interplay of textures and flavors—from sharp and piquant to mild and buttery—defines an exceptional version. Quality ingredients, proper aging, and precise preparation technique are essential to achieving the desired complexity.

## Regional Variations

Different Italian regions offer distinct interpretations. Northern versions often incorporate local Alpine cheeses like Parmigiano-Reggiano and Taleggio, while central Italian preparations may feature Pecorino Romano and softer varieties. Some preparations include complementary ingredients such as honey, nuts, or cured meats to enhance the cheese profile.
